## Deployment

The Larkspool build migrated from the old shell-script pipeline to the hermetic Cindervault build system in Q3. All dependencies are now pinned and fetched from the internal mirror, so builds are reproducible across agents. If a deploy fails, do not patch the sandbox manually — rebuild from a clean checkout instead. Release artifacts are signed at the end of the pipeline and pushed to the staging shelf for promotion. The deploy job reads the following configuration values at startup.

service settings:
[casax]
port = 6379
team = rusir
host = casax.zemvarhq.corp
region = outer-4
access_code = ac_9808ce
timeout_ms = 1500

Subject: Bulk-edit cut-over complete

Team — the Ledgewick admin table now routes all bulk edits through the new Quorra batch service. Legacy inline edits are disabled, and rollback requires re-enabling the old handler flag within two hours of an incident. For on-call reference, the service currently runs with the configuration printed below.

deployment values, kajep-kageg:
[praix]
host = praix.paliqcorp.corp
user = praix_svc
database = praix_prod

MEMO — Board Distribution

Subject: Vexhall Region Sales Review

Q3 bookings in the Vexhall territory fell 9% against plan. Renewals held steady; new logo acquisition lagged. Marla Denning's team has reforecast Q4 conservatively. Pipeline quality, not volume, is the issue. Corrective staffing moves begin next month. The confidential outlook for the region follows below.

confidential, kajof-tahof: The pricing group signed off on a budget of $491.8 million for Project Casvan.